ZOLL MANUFACTURING CORPORATION LIFEVEST WCD 4000 SYSTEM; WEARABLE CARDIOVERTER DEFIBRILLATOR Back to Search Results
Model Number WCD 4000
Device Problem Patient-Device Incompatibility (2682)
Patient Problems Itching Sensation (1943); Skin Irritation (2076); Reaction (2414)
Event Date 06/23/2020
Event Type  Injury  
Manufacturer Narrative
Biocompatibility testing to iso 10993 was successfully completed on skin-contacting surfaces of the lifevest device as well as the blue¿ defibrillation gel.
 
Event Description
A us distributor contacted zoll to report that a patient developed a skin irritation.The irritation was described itchy but open wounds or blisters.The patient was described the irritation as under the therapy pads.The patient's rn assisted with applying unscented lotion to the irritated areas.The outcome is unknown the patient reported garment was still itching, support services suggested making the doctor aware if itching continues.
